The first one is simply being aware that you need some additional storage space. (Squashing one more thing in the “fun” closet may be the clue you needed) This step will inspire you to create the perfect space for you and your family. But now that you are inspired to act, exactly what do you do? Here are the next 5 steps you will need to take to get the results you are looking for:

* Look though the room or rooms that are giving you problems and determine what kind of storage space you will need in each location; or do you want to move things to another location and alleviate the need for extra storage in your living areas all together. (also consider computer data storage, kids toys, shoes and security as well as a building on your site.)

* Think in terms of future needs so you can make your plans to absorb any unforeseen space that you may need. It’s better to have too much storage than not enough.

* Look at what you can spend so you can stay within your planned budget. You may need to save for a few weeks or months to optimize your project.

* Don’t overlook the power of the purge! Can you reach your needed space goals by purging, organizing or cleaning? It’s amazing what you might be able to accomplish with these 3 techniques and these are free! (excluding cleaning products)

* Is your storage solution something you can do totally on your own or do you need some professional help to get it done the way you envision? It’s better to get help upfront as opposed to having a project partially completed.

Your storage and space needs will be different than the next person’s, as will be your skill level. These steps are designed for you to think about your needs and come up with the perfect resolution to solve your need for more space. Once you know what you need to do then you can map out the steps in your personal design and get going.
